//===--- PlatformKind.cpp - Swift Language Platform Kinds -----------------===// // // This source file is part of the Swift.org open source project // // Copyright (c) 2014 - 2016 Apple Inc. and the Swift project authors // Licensed under Apache License v2.0 with Runtime Library Exception // // See http://swift.org/LICENSE.txt for license information // See http://swift.org/CONTRIBUTORS.txt for the list of Swift project authors // //===----------------------------------------------------------------------===// // // This file implements the platform kinds for API availability. // //===----------------------------------------------------------------------===// #include "swift/AST/PlatformKind.h" #include "swift/Basic/LangOptions.h" #include "llvm/ADT/StringSwitch.h" #include "llvm/Support/ErrorHandling.h" using namespace swift; StringRef swift::platformString(PlatformKind platform) { switch (platform) { case PlatformKind::none: return "*"; #define AVAILABILITY_PLATFORM(X, PrettyName) \ case PlatformKind::X: \ return #X; #include "swift/AST/PlatformKinds.def" } llvm_unreachable("bad PlatformKind"); } StringRef swift::prettyPlatformString(PlatformKind platform) { switch (platform) { case PlatformKind::none: return "*"; #define AVAILABILITY_PLATFORM(X, PrettyName) \ case PlatformKind::X: \ return PrettyName; #include "swift/AST/PlatformKinds.def" } llvm_unreachable("bad PlatformKind"); } Optional swift::platformFromString(StringRef Name) { if (Name == "*") return PlatformKind::none; return llvm::StringSwitch>(Name) #define AVAILABILITY_PLATFORM(X, PrettyName) .Case(#X, PlatformKind::X) #include "swift/AST/PlatformKinds.def" .Default(Optional()); } bool swift::isPlatformActive(PlatformKind Platform, LangOptions &LangOpts) { if (Platform == PlatformKind::none) return true; if (Platform == PlatformKind::OSXApplicationExtension || Platform == PlatformKind::iOSApplicationExtension) if (!LangOpts.EnableAppExtensionRestrictions) return false; // FIXME: This is an awful way to get the current OS. switch (Platform) { case PlatformKind::OSX: case PlatformKind::OSXApplicationExtension: return LangOpts.Target.isMacOSX(); case PlatformKind::iOS: case PlatformKind::iOSApplicationExtension: return LangOpts.Target.isiOS() && !LangOpts.Target.isTvOS(); case PlatformKind::tvOS: case PlatformKind::tvOSApplicationExtension: return LangOpts.Target.isTvOS(); case PlatformKind::watchOS: case PlatformKind::watchOSApplicationExtension: return LangOpts.Target.isWatchOS(); case PlatformKind::none: llvm_unreachable("handled above"); } llvm_unreachable("bad PlatformKind"); } PlatformKind swift::targetPlatform(LangOptions &LangOpts) { if (LangOpts.Target.isMacOSX()) { return (LangOpts.EnableAppExtensionRestrictions ? PlatformKind::OSXApplicationExtension : PlatformKind::OSX); } if (LangOpts.Target.isTvOS()) { return (LangOpts.EnableAppExtensionRestrictions ? PlatformKind::tvOSApplicationExtension : PlatformKind::tvOS); } if (LangOpts.Target.isWatchOS()) { return (LangOpts.EnableAppExtensionRestrictions ? PlatformKind::watchOSApplicationExtension : PlatformKind::watchOS); } if (LangOpts.Target.isiOS()) { return (LangOpts.EnableAppExtensionRestrictions ? PlatformKind::iOSApplicationExtension : PlatformKind::iOS); } return PlatformKind::none; }
